Jon David Grudenis an American former college football player and professional coach. He was the head coach of the Oakland Raiders and the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, winning Super Bowl XXXVII in his first year with the Buccaneers. At the time, Gruden was the youngest head coach ever to win a Super Bowl at age 39 years, 5 months and 9 days...
